The scrimshaw of aggression is a pocket slot item. It is obtained in inactive form from the loot crates awarded upon killing the Giant Mimic, or from the Motherlode Maw.

While active, a random monster around the player will become aggressive and attack. Only one monster will be aggressive at a time through the effect of this scrimshaw and it will only activate while not currently under attack. As such, while it can offer a low-intensity method of staying in combat for extended periods of time, it is not recommended for those choosing to use multi-target or area of effect weapons to kill masses of enemies.

Each scrimshaw of aggression will last for one hour of activation before crumbling to dust. The scrimshaw can be upgraded to a superior version that lasts for 4 hours using 10 ancient bones at the Scrimshaw Crafter, once the ability to do so is purchased from the Elite Dungeon Reward Shop for 250,000 Dungeoneering tokens.

Like all scrimshaw, partially used scrimshaw of aggression can be combined to sum the time remaining (to a maximum of 1 hour per scrimshaw).

The inactive scrimshaw may be combined with a scrimshaw of sacrifice (inactive) to form a scrimshaw of corruption (inactive).

The item was originally obtainable for a limited time from Treasure Hunter during the corrupted chests promotion. It was later made available again from 18 February 2016 to 22 February 2016 during 'The Mimic Rises' Treasure Hunter promotion, as a potential reward from large and huge loot crates. It was then available a third time from 17 November 2016 to 21 November during 'The Revenge of the Giant Mimic' promotion. On 4 September 2017, the scrimshaw was also made obtainable from the Motherlode Maw, and availability was further extended as a reward from Giant Mimic when the boss returned permanently on 5 February 2018.
